What Alok Industries Limited does
Alok Industries is a vertically integrated Indian textile manufacturer operating across two segments. In cotton, it is integrated from spinning through weaving, processing and finished fabrics to bedsheets, towels and garments. In polyester, it runs continuous polymerisation from PTA and MEG into melt, which is converted into polyester chips and then POY, FDY, DTY and PSF. Its customer base spans global retail brands, textile importers, private labels, domestic retailers, and other garment and textile manufacturers and traders. Reliance Industries Limited and JM Financial Asset Reconstruction Company are the company's controlling stakeholders following its 2017-2019 insolvency resolution, and the company transacts with related parties including Reliance Industries (raw materials/job-work) and Reliance Retail (purchase/sale of fabrics and readymade garments); since March 2024 its polyester business has operated on a job-work model.
